diff options
author | Karl Berry <karl@freefriends.org> | 2006-01-12 23:56:55 +0000 |
---|---|---|
committer | Karl Berry <karl@freefriends.org> | 2006-01-12 23:56:55 +0000 |
commit | 8d9974705d5deaf4314ccf44b2b5bb349c3f768b (patch) | |
tree | 57a59c2fe08373d075282e2835f9664c789a4764 /Master/texmf-dist/tex/latex/hyper/article.hyp | |
parent | 1787e3b52f868fb3f72413c3d0f8dd49dd884f05 (diff) |
hyper
git-svn-id: svn://tug.org/texlive/trunk@984 c570f23f-e606-0410-a88d-b1316a301751
Diffstat (limited to 'Master/texmf-dist/tex/latex/hyper/article.hyp')
-rw-r--r-- | Master/texmf-dist/tex/latex/hyper/article.hyp | 140 |
1 files changed, 140 insertions, 0 deletions
diff --git a/Master/texmf-dist/tex/latex/hyper/article.hyp b/Master/texmf-dist/tex/latex/hyper/article.hyp new file mode 100644 index 00000000000..be3da7a85d4 --- /dev/null +++ b/Master/texmf-dist/tex/latex/hyper/article.hyp @@ -0,0 +1,140 @@ +%% +%% This is file `article.hyp', +%% generated with the docstrip utility. +%% +%% The original source files were: +%% +%% hyper.dtx (with options: `article') +%% +%% File: hyper.dtx Copyright (C) 1995--1999 Michael Mehlich +%% This program can be redistributed and/or modified under the terms +%% of the LaTeX Project Public License Distributed from CTAN +%% archives in directory macros/latex/base/lppl.txt; either +%% version 1 of the License, or any later version. +\def\fileversion{V4.2d} +\def\filedate{1999/03/09} +\def\docdate{1999/03/09} +%% +%% \CharacterTable +%% {Upper-case \A\B\C\D\E\F\G\H\I\J\K\L\M\N\O\P\Q\R\S\T\U\V\W\X\Y\Z +%% Lower-case \a\b\c\d\e\f\g\h\i\j\k\l\m\n\o\p\q\r\s\t\u\v\w\x\y\z +%% Digits \0\1\2\3\4\5\6\7\8\9 +%% Exclamation \! Double quote \" Hash (number) \# +%% Dollar \$ Percent \% Ampersand \& +%% Acute accent \' Left paren \( Right paren \) +%% Asterisk \* Plus \+ Comma \, +%% Minus \- Point \. Solidus \/ +%% Colon \: Semicolon \; Less than \< +%% Equals \= Greater than \> Question mark \? +%% Commercial at \@ Left bracket \[ Backslash \\ +%% Right bracket \] Circumflex \^ Underscore \_ +%% Grave accent \` Left brace \{ Vertical bar \| +%% Right brace \} Tilde \~} +%% +\let\hyper@part\@part +\def\@part[#1]#2{% + \ifnum\c@secnumdepth>% +-1\relax% + \refstepcounter{part}% + \ignore@next@refstepcounter% + \else% + \hyper@setcurrent% + \fi% + \hyper@settype{part}% + \global\let\@currenthyper\@currenthyper% + \global\let\@currenthypertype\@currenthypertype% + \callwithexpandedhyperref% + {\hyper@part}% + {#1}% + {\hyperanchor{\@currenthyper}{#2}}% +} +\let\hyper@spart\@spart +\def\@spart#1{% + \hyper@setcurrent% + \hyper@settype{part}% + \global\let\@currenthyper\@currenthyper% + \global\let\@currenthypertype\@currenthypertype% + \hyper@spart{\hyperanchor{\@currenthyper}{#1}}% +} +\def\hyper@mkboth@do[#1][#2]{% + \markboth{#1}{#2}% +} +\def\hyper@mkboth#1#2{% + \callwithexpandedhyperref% + {\callwithexpandedhyperref{\hyper@mkboth@do}{#1}}% + {#2}% +} +\let\hyper@ps@headings\ps@headings +\def\ps@headings{% + \hyper@ps@headings% + \let\@mkboth\hyper@mkboth% +} +\let\hyper@makecaption\@makecaption +\long\def\@makecaption#1#2{% + \hyper@makecaption{\hyperanchor{\@currenthyper}{#1}}{#2}% +} +\let\hyper@makefntext\@makefntext% +\long\def\@makefntext#1{% + \bgroup% + \hyper@currentfnmark% + \edef\@currenthyper{\hyper@current@fnmark}% + \let\@makefnmark\hyper@makefnmark@text% + \hyper@makefntext{#1}% + \egroup% +} +\if@titlepage\else +\renewcommand\maketitle{\par + \begingroup + \renewcommand\thefootnote{\fnsymbol{footnote}}% + \def\@makefnmark{% + \hyper@currentfnmark% + \rlap{\@textsuperscript{% + \normalfont% + \hyperreference{\hyper@current@fnmark}% + {\@thefnmark}% + }}% + }% + \long\def\@makefntext##1{% + \hyper@currentfnmark% + \bgroup% + \edef\@currenthyper{\hyper@current@fnmark}% + \parindent 1em\noindent + \hb@xt@1.8em{% + \hss\@textsuperscript{% + \normalfont% + \hyperanchor{\hyper@current@fnmark}{\@thefnmark} + }% + }% + ##1% + \egroup% + }% + \if@twocolumn + \ifnum \col@number=\@ne + \@maketitle + \else + \twocolumn[\@maketitle]% + \fi + \else + \newpage + \global\@topnum\z@ + \@maketitle + \fi + \thispagestyle{plain}\@thanks + \endgroup + \setcounter{footnote}{0}% + \let\thanks\relax + \let\maketitle\relax\let\@maketitle\relax + \gdef\@thanks{}\gdef\@author{}\gdef\@title{}} +\fi +\let\hyper@titlepage\titlepage +\def\titlepage{% + \hyper@titlepage% + \if@compatibility% + \global\setcounter{page}{0}% + \else% + \global\setcounter{page}{-1}% + \fi% +} +\endinput +%% +%% End of file `article.hyp'. |